Little B’s Bakery in Canada is recalling two types of Coconut Haystacks, because they contain an undeclared allergen: sulfites. The product is a macaroon.
Product details:
- Chocolate Coconut Haystacks
- 380 grams
- Best Before dates up to and including May 18, 2012
- No UPC number
- Coconut Haystacks
- 320 grams
- Best Before dates up to and including May 18, 2012
- No UPC number
- Both products were distributed in Ontario
For questions, call the CFIA at 1-800-442-2342.
